Since the lathe I bought is three phase and I have a surface grinder that is also three phase , I am going to build my own RPC , with with a pony motor to start it . I understand the major wiring of the three phase side of it . What is giving me hell is how to start and stop the pony motor . I am planning on starting the pony and then engaging the belt to spin up the idler , what I need is a remote start/stop/energize station . The RPC will not be inside my shop for now , I have been scratching my head on how to start the motor without having a service disconnect next to the lever to engage the belt . I have a three phase contactor that can be used to power up the idler but where can I find a single phase contactor to start and stop the pony motor ? I have followed some of the links provided in different threads but to no avail :confused: . Could one of you direct me to a site where I could get one ? I have 90% of what I need to build the RPC , I hate to cobble something together when a self contained system would look more professional . Dan
